Abstract

This utility model relates to the field of forklift attachment technology and discloses a carton clamp for forklifts, including a base assembly, two clamping arm assemblies arranged opposite to each other and slidably connected to the base assembly, a cylinder assembly fixed to the base assembly, and a hydraulic system communicating with the cylinder assembly. A backrest is installed on the base assembly. The hydraulic system includes a control valve and a pressure regulating valve that are interconnected. The control valve is fixed to the top of the base assembly, and the pressure regulating valve is fixedly connected to the backrest via a mounting plate. This utility model optimizes the installation position of the pressure regulating valve in the hydraulic system, making the installation and removal of the carton clamp as a forklift attachment more convenient. It also avoids the problem of traditional pressure regulating valves requiring manual drilling into the forklift mast during installation, which could potentially damage the integrity and load-bearing capacity of the forklift mast.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of forklift attachment technology, specifically a carton clamp for forklifts. Background Technology

[0002] Cardboard box clamps are forklift attachments mainly used in the handling of cardboard boxes and other packaging materials. They are widely used in warehousing and logistics scenarios in industries such as home appliances and food and beverages. Using cardboard box clamps can improve handling efficiency and reduce the risk of cardboard box damage. Through hydraulically driven clamping arms, they can quickly clamp, efficiently transfer, and stack cardboard box goods such as refrigerators, televisions, and washing machines.

[0003] However, existing carton clamps, such as the one described in patent CN205933104U, have their hydraulic system control valve installed on the base assembly of the carton clamp, while the pressure regulating valve is installed on the forklift mast. Therefore, when installing the pressure regulating valve, the OEM needs to install the carton clamp on the forklift first and then manually drill holes in the forklift mast to install it. This not only weakens the load-bearing capacity of the forklift mast, but also makes the oil circuit connection between the pressure regulating valve and the control valve more complicated. Furthermore, when replacing other forklift attachments, the pressure regulating valve must be disassembled before the carton clamp can be removed from the forklift. This makes the overall installation and disassembly process cumbersome, complicated, and very inconvenient.

[0004] In conclusion, there is an urgent need for a forklift carton clamp to optimize the installation position of the pressure regulating valve. Utility Model Content

[0005] The purpose of this utility model is to provide a forklift carton clamp to solve the problems mentioned in the background art, so as to achieve stable clamping of the upper end of the goods and optimize the installation position of the pressure regulating valve.

[0006]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: A forklift carton clamp includes a base assembly, two opposing clamping arm assemblies slidably connected to the base assembly, a cylinder assembly fixed to the base assembly, and a hydraulic system communicating with the cylinder assembly. A retaining shelf is mounted on the base assembly. The hydraulic system includes a control valve and a pressure regulating valve communicating with each other. The control valve is fixed to the top of the base assembly, and the pressure regulating valve is fixedly connected to the retaining shelf via a mounting plate.

[0007] As a further embodiment of this utility model: to facilitate the operation of the regulating valve, the mounting plate is located on one side edge of the barrier rack and fixed between the two crossbeams of the barrier rack, and the mounting plate is fixedly connected to the pressure regulating valve by bolts.

[0008] As a further embodiment of this utility model: in order to clamp the carton goods and facilitate slight angle adjustments to balance the force on both sides of the clamping arm plate, the clamping arm assembly includes a guide rail assembly, the guide rail assembly is vertically connected to the clamping arm plate through a connecting rib plate, the clamping arm plate is rotatably connected to a stabilizing frame, and the stabilizing frame is fixedly connected to a clamping plate.

[0009] As a further embodiment of this utility model: in order to ensure that sufficient clamping force can be applied to the upper end of the carton goods and that the clamping plate has both high strength and light weight, the height of the stabilizing frame is the same as that of the clamping plate, and the clamping plate is an integral aluminum sulfide plate.

[0010] As a further embodiment of this utility model: to prevent the bottom of the stabilizer from directly contacting the ground and causing wear, a pad is provided at the bottom of the stabilizer.

[0011] As a further embodiment of this utility model: in order to enable the hydraulic cylinder assembly to drive the clamping arm assembly to move, clamping arm plate blocks are fixedly provided at the top and bottom of the clamping arm plate, and a hydraulic cylinder support is fixedly provided on the side near the guide rail assembly, and the telescopic rod of the hydraulic cylinder assembly is fixedly connected to the hydraulic cylinder support.

[0012] As a further embodiment of this utility model: in order to enable the two clamping arm assemblies to move relative to each other to clamp goods, the base assembly includes a base plate, and two guide rail seats are installed on the front side of the base plate, which are arranged horizontally. The guide rail assembly is slidably connected in the guide rail seats, and the hydraulic cylinder assembly drives the two clamping arm assemblies to move horizontally relative to each other or opposite to each other along the length direction of the guide rail seats.

[0013] As a further embodiment of this utility model: to fix the cylinder barrel of the hydraulic cylinder assembly to the base assembly, the base plate is fixedly connected to the hydraulic cylinder assembly through a fixing seat, and the fixing seat is fixedly connected to the front side of the base plate.

[0014] As a further embodiment of this utility model: in order to prevent gravel from entering the guide rail seat and to provide auxiliary support for the goods, a baffle is fixedly connected to the bottom of the base plate.

[0015]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are: This utility model features a novel structure. By installing the pressure regulating valve on the retaining rack, it eliminates the need for drilling holes in the forklift mast, and also facilitates the removal and installation of cardboard boxes on the forklift. Furthermore, the matching height between the stabilizing frame and the clamping plate avoids the problem of the upper part of the clamping plate not being able to firmly press the top of tall boxes or high-center-of-gravity goods, thus improving clamping stability. [0020] Please see Figure 1-7 In this embodiment of the utility model, a forklift carton clamp includes a base assembly 1, two clamping arm assemblies 2 that are arranged opposite to each other and slidably connected to the base assembly 1, a cylinder assembly 3 fixed to the base assembly 1, and a hydraulic system 4 communicating with the cylinder assembly 3.

[0021]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 5 The base assembly 1 includes a base plate 11, with the side of the base plate 11 furthest from the operator defined as the front side. Two horizontally arranged guide rail seats 12 are mounted on the front side of the base plate 11. Wear-resistant blocks 121 are bolted into the guide rail seats 12 to reduce friction when the guide rail assembly 25 of the clamping arm assembly 2 slides within the guide rail seats 12, thus reducing wear on the guide rail seats 12. A hydraulic cylinder assembly 3 is fixedly connected to the base assembly 1. Fixed seats 111 are vertically welded to both sides of the base plate 11 to fix the cylinder of the hydraulic cylinder assembly 3. The fixed seats 111 are located on the front side of the base plate 11. A baffle 13 is bolted to the bottom of the base plate 11 to provide auxiliary support for the bottom of the goods and prevent gravel from entering the guide rail seats 12 and affecting the operation of the carton clamp. A lower hook 112 and an upper hook are mounted on the rear bottom of the base plate 11 for mounting the carton clamp onto a forklift. In this embodiment, to reduce its weight, the guide rail base 12 is made of 7005-T6 aluminum alloy.

[0022] Reference Figure 1 A retaining shelf 5 is fixedly connected to the top of the base plate 11. The vertical section of the L-shaped connecting plate at the bottom of the retaining shelf 5 is fastened to the top of the base plate 11 by bolts. The horizontal section of the L-shaped connecting plate at the bottom of the retaining shelf 5 is fastened to the top of the guide rail seat 12 located at the top of the base plate 11 by bolts. (Refer to...) Figure 2 The mounting plate 51 is welded to the upper and middle crossbeams of the barrier rack 5 on both sides, and the mounting plate 51 is located on one side edge of the barrier rack 5, so as to facilitate the adjustment of the pressure regulating valve 42.

[0023]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 3The hydraulic system 4 is connected to the cylinder assembly 3. The pressure regulating valve 42 of the hydraulic system 4 is fastened to the mounting plate 51 by a screw. The pressure regulating valve 42 is connected to the control valve 41 through a pipeline. The control valve 41 is fastened to the top center of the guide rail seat 12 located on the top of the base plate 11 by bolts. The control valve 41 is connected to the two cylinders of the cylinder assembly 3 through pipelines. A cover plate assembly 31 is fixed on the side of the cylinder assembly 3 near the clamping arm assembly 2 to protect the cylinder assembly 3 from external interference. In this embodiment, the pressure regulating valve 42 is a four-position pressure regulating valve.

[0024] Reference Figure 1 , Figure 6 and Figure 7 The clamping arm assembly 2 includes a guide rail assembly 25, which is connected to the clamping arm plate 21 via a connecting stiffener 24. The clamping arm plate 21 is connected to the clamping plate 23 via a stabilizer 22. The stabilizer 22 and the clamping plate 23 are fastened together with bolts. The stabilizer 22 and the clamping plate 23 are at the same height, allowing the stabilizer 22 to apply a horizontal pressure force to the top of the clamping plate 23, preventing the clamping plate from only receiving force from the lower part of the clamping plate from the stabilizer 22, thus avoiding the problem of insufficient clamping of the top of the goods due to no direct force on the top of the clamping plate. The guide rail assembly 25 is slidably connected within the guide rail seat 12 of the base assembly 1, allowing the clamping arm assembly 2 to drive the clamping plate 23 to move relative to or away from each other along the length of the guide rail seat 12. The clamping arm plate 21 is perpendicular to the guide rail assembly 25. The clamping plate 23 is specifically an integral aluminum sulfide plate made of high-strength alloy aluminum, giving the clamping plate 23 both high strength and light weight.

[0025] The clamping arm plate 21 is rotatably connected to the stabilizing frame 22 via a steel back bearing and a pin, allowing the stabilizing frame 22 to drive the clamping plate 23 to make slight angle adjustments according to the carton body, ensuring a closer fit between the clamping plate 23 and the surface of the goods, preventing uneven force on the goods and thus affecting clamping stability. Clamping arm plate stops 211 are welded to both the top and bottom of the clamping arm plate 21. One side of the clamping arm plate stop 211 is fixed to the clamping arm plate 21, and the other side extends beyond the edge of the clamping arm plate 21. The stabilizing frame 22 has stabilizing frame stops 222 welded to the corresponding positions on the clamping arm plate 21. One side of the stabilizing frame stop 222 is fixed to the edge of the stabilizing frame 22, and the other side extends beyond the edge of the stabilizing frame 22. The extended portion of the stabilizing frame stop 222 is located outside the clamping arm plate stop 211, used to limit the rotation range of the stabilizing frame 22 relative to the clamping arm plate 21. Two pads 221 are fixedly connected to both sides of the bottom end of the stabilizing frame 22 to prevent the bottom of the stabilizing frame 22 from directly contacting the ground and causing wear.

[0026] Reference Figure 6The clamping arm plate 21 has a cylinder support 212 welded to the side near the guide rail assembly 25. The cylinder support 212 is fixedly connected to the telescopic rod of the cylinder assembly 3, so that the cylinder assembly 3 can drive the two clamping arm assemblies 2 to move, thereby driving the two clamping plates 23 to move horizontally relative to each other or opposite to each other along the length direction of the guide rail seat 12.

[0027] This utility model has a novel structure and stable operation. When using this utility model, there is no need to drill holes in the forklift mast before installing the pressure regulating valve 42 on the forklift mast. Instead, the pressure regulating valve 42 is directly installed on the mounting plate 51 of the rack 5 with bolts. After the carton clamp attachment is installed on the forklift, the pressure regulating valve 42 is adjusted according to the size of the carton, the packaging strength and the specific weight of the goods to be transported, so as to set a suitable clamping force for the clamping plate 23. This ensures that the goods will not be damaged due to excessive clamping force or slip due to insufficient clamping force during the transportation process. Then, the extension and retraction of the telescopic rod of the oil cylinder assembly 3 is controlled by the hydraulic system 4, thereby driving the two clamping arm assemblies 2 to move the clamping plate 23 horizontally relative to each other or backward on the base assembly 1, thereby adjusting the distance between the clamping plates 23 to complete the clamping of the carton.
